Abstract
Molecular marker has been widely used on various aspects of grapevine breeding,which is one of important genetic markers developed from molecular biology.Molecular markers facilitated the research on investigation the origin of existed grapevine cultivars and provided a powerful tool for creating of new grapevine cultivars.The application of molecular markers,genetic mapping and molecular marker-assisted breeding in grapevine germplasm in recent years were summarized and the application prospects of molecular markers in grapevine breeding were evaluated in this paper.What's more,the existed problems in grapevine breeding were pointed out to provide foundations for molecular markers application in germlpasm resource research and marker-assisted breeding grapevine.
